Output 4270094680371faf6e20b14fec26403355461ae0bc0145c526bf2c27d03fde93:18

value
107694
script pubkey
OP_0 OP_PUSHBYTES_20 cc1751ee992a1558af175840a0f9fd677861e20c
address
bc1qest4rm5e9g243tchtpq2p70avauxrcsver9mv2
transaction
4270094680371faf6e20b14fec26403355461ae0bc0145c526bf2c27d03fde93
spent
true